Well, what makes a good car design for you? How has a car to look like to please your eye, what lines should the design have, how should it "feel" when you look at it etc. For example you could even come up with an own drawing or another car for example and show what you like about it etc.

In my case for example, the Jaguar XFR with its new facelift combines some certain lines from Audis (look at the front from the bottom up to the bonnet or the rear lights (which I don't like, older ones were much nicer)) with the typical elegance of a Jaguar without compromising an overall sporty and dynamic look. This is as well caused by the shape of the head lights that give the XFR a certain aggressiveness and make it much more compact than an Audi for example. The Audi would have a huge-looking front compared to this and would have to gain back its sportiness through small wind visors, splitters, spoilers etc. Another thing is the outmost line raising up from the headlights and then trailing down to the rear, giving the car a pretty distinct "edge" all around which is then joined together by the upper edge of the rear.

I actually kind of like design of the new GM Ampera. The deep airvents below the headlights look aggressive and for a green eco car, unlike the Toyota Prius and G-Wiz, this car doesn't look like a donkey's backside. I also like the fact that this hatchback doesn't look like a glorified compact car, it actually looks like a sedan, just like the 80's and 90's hatchbacks e.g BMW 316i, Renault Laguna 1, Vauxhall Astra Mk4 etc.

wikipedia wrote:The Pagani Huayra (pronounced waɪ-rah) is an Italian mid-engined sports car produced by Pagani. The second car produced by Pagani, it succeeds the Pagani Zonda. It will cost £850,000[1] when it goes on sale in the spring. It is named after Huayra-tata, a South American wind god. It also makes reference to a 1969 Argentine Sports Car, the Huayra Pronello Ford.
